CORN Strategies Snapshot

TREND: The trend for March corn is sideways for now.

NONCOMMERCIAL OUTLOOK: Noncommercial corn traders held a net-short futures position of 18,330 contracts as of Feb. 10 and were net-buyers of 16,368 contracts during the CFTC reporting period as prices have rallied off lows set following the bearish January WASDE report.

COMMERCIAL OUTLOOK: Commercial corn traders held a net-long position of 37,338 contracts as of Feb. 10 and were net-sellers of 15,578 contracts through the CFTC reporting period. The March 2026 contract is priced 10 1/4 cents lower than the May 2026 contract, moving wider (more carry) through the week, to the highest degree of carry for the boards since early September.
